    Graduating seniors from colleges and universities throughout the United States and Canada are invited to apply to become a Joseph A. O'Hare, S.J., Postgraduate Media Fellow.

    The O'Hare Fellowship supports the next generation of content producers for the Catholic media and other forms of professional journalism. The fellowship offers three recent graduates of U.S. and Canadian colleges or universities the opportunity to develop their media skills and professional relationships while living and working in the capital of global communications, New York City.

    O’Hare fellows spend one full year working at the offices of America Media, where they will generate content for America’s multiple platforms: print, web, digital, social media and events. 

    Applications open September 1, priority will be given to applications received by November 30, and the final deadline is January 1, 2022.
